Astera Labs introduced Scorpio X-Series 320-lane switch targeting 49% collective IO reduction for fragmented AI workloads. Shipments to hyperscalers began, with broad ramp in H2 2026. Astera Labs this week introduced its Scorpio X-Series 320-lane smart fabric switch, targeting idle GPU compute in hyperscaler clusters. The memory-semantic architecture cuts collective IO by 49%, according to analyst Brendan Burke of Futurum [per the source]. Key facts Scorpio X-Series has 320 lanes for high-radix fabric switching. Memory-semantic architecture enables load/store accelerator access. Analyst: cutting collective IO by 49% boosts GPU utilization. Shipments to hyperscalers began; broad ramp in H2 2026. Hypercast engine offloads collective operations into the fabric. The gap between how AI clusters are designed and how they actually run is costing hyperscalers billions in idle compute. Astera Labs is attacking that mismatch with a new high-radix fabric switch that rethinks data movement at scale.…
